I don't get all the hate for things being done. I understand the bad taste for Sbisa signing . I won't touch the Miller contract .
Every move can not be a home run. Since JB has come in he has added some nice pieces that seem ready or close to ready.
I know Bo is a MG add, but Benning put him immediately into the mix. He also found JV Boeser McCann who are a year or two away. I am sure Sven will find his way into the NHL .
Sutter is a 20 goal player last year and Canucks need to find him good linemates to repeat. Sutter would have been one of the most sought after UFAs next year and Benning beat the rush and paid him a very fair raise from what was paid by the Pens as he enters his prime.
We are getting younger and this time around we are putting top 6 players in to fill the spots and not using bottom 6 players to fill the roles like the previous regime did. |

If you look at the Sutter move JB did the right thing by bringing in a buffer for Bo. No need to put pressure on a 20 year old kid to be the next one on this team.
Most top UFA centres next year will be re-signed by their current teams. So who would have been available to step in as second line centre? I think looking at the list JB made the right choice.
This top 6 needed a huge improvement when he took over. He added Sutter Sven JV and Vrbata . That is a big improvement over Kassian Burrows Higgins Hansen and Bonino.
I think they are making improvements but it will take 3 years to enjoy it. You won't see the rewards this year , I don't think. |
